Baron Davis’ Li Ning BD Doom

words & images_Nick DePaula

Here we have a look at the home colorway of the Li Ning BD Doom that Baron Davis has been wearing all season long. After first showing you the away version last month, this home colorway doesn’t differ too greatly in appearance and features a combination synthetic and patent leather upper.

With its glossy midsole, polka-dotted laces and recognizable ‘Baron’s Beard’ tongue pull tab, the BD Doom will see a release during the first half of 2010 here in the US and will be priced at $100.
